Pisga Camp Shed
Pisga Camp Shed is a building in Devikulam, Idukki district, Kerala and has an elevation of 1,421 metres.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Adimali
Town
Photo: Wikistranger, Public domain.
Adimali is a town in the Idukki district of Kerala, in southwestern India. Adimaly is located on the National Highway 85, known as Kochi-Thondi National Highway, earlier known as the Kochi Madhura Highway connecting Kochi and Madurai, India. Adimali is situated 8 km south of Pisga Camp Shed.
Pallivasal
Village
Photo: Rainer Halama,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Pallivasal is a village in Idukki district in the southwestern Indian state of Kerala. The first hydro-electric project in Kerala was established at Pallivasal during the reign of Maharajah Sree Chithira Thirunal Balarama Varma. Pallivasal is situated 9 km east of Pisga Camp Shed.
